However generous a free bonus appears, the bridge between “bonus winnings” and “cashable funds” is always the wagering requirement. At Hugewin Casino I found a transparent set of rules displayed directly inside the “Bonus Terms” section of the promotions page, not tucked away in a dense PDF. During my examination, the free spins bonus carried a 35x playthrough on the winnings generated, while an active no deposit cash chip required the bonus amount to be wagered 40 times before any transfer. That meant if I won €15 from free spins, I had to place bets totalling €525 on eligible games before asking for a payout. The contribution of different game categories differed significantly: all slot titles accounted for 100%, but table games like blackjack and roulette commonly counted only 5% towards the requirement, and live dealer games often stood at zero. I discovered that lesson quickly when I briefly changed to live roulette and saw my wagering progress bar barely moved—an important detail that many new players overlook. Reading the exact weightings before selecting a game saved me from accidentally invalidating my bonus progress, and I suggest doing the same every single time you trigger a promotion.
Following fulfilling the playthrough, the casino imposes a ceiling on how much of the bonus-derived money you can actually payout. The terms I found set a maximum withdrawal limit of €50 for no deposit free spins and €100 for free chip offers, though these figures can vary between campaigns. Anything above that cap was automatically removed from my balance during the withdrawal process, which initially frustrated me until I recognised it as a standard industry practice intended to protect the house while still providing a tangible reward. The free bonus had a seven-day expiry clock beginning from the moment it was granted. I observed the countdown timer in my account lobby and guaranteed to complete the wagering requirement well before the deadline expired; leftover bonus funds and any pending winnings simply disappeared when the timer hit zero.
